Adoption and Children (Scotland) Act 2007

Section 74 - Disclosure of medical information about parents of child

269.Subsection (1) gives the Scottish Ministers power to make regulations in relation to the disclosure of information about the health of the natural parents of a child who will be, may be, or has been adopted.

270.Any such regulations must ensure that a person to whom such information is disclosed is subject to a duty of confidentiality in respect of this information (subsection (2)).

271.However, by virtue of subsection (3), information may be disclosed to the child and to persons who are to, or may, adopt, or have already adopted the child.

272.Subsection (4) lists matters which any regulations made by virtue of subsection (1) may cover. These are: the types of persons by whom and to whom such information is to be disclosed; the circumstances in which this information is to be disclosed; the type of information which is or is not to be disclosed; the circumstances in which consent to the disclosure of such information is not required; and the processing of the information.

Explanatory Notes

Text created by the Scottish Government to explain what the Act sets out to achieve and to make the Act accessible to readers who are not legally qualified. Explanatory Notes were introduced in 1999 and accompany all Acts of the Scottish Parliament except those which result from Budget Bills.
